Share on Facebook0Share on Google+0Tweet about this on Twitter0


Glee Spoilers: Rachel and Finn on Valentine’s Day — Engagement Ring Photos!

If you don’t like Glee spoilers, then go away. Seriously, go far, FAR away! Okay... gone yet? Because we just found some brand-new photos from the set of Glee’s upcoming Valentine’s Day episode, and Rachel (Lea Michele) is wearing an engagement ring!